Who decides what Props make the ballot?

from Rage for Justice Report · host Consumer Watchdog

When the cost to qualify a ballot measure in California approaches $5 million – like it did this year – are initiatives still a tool of direct democracy? Consumer Watchdog President Jamie Court is joined by Executive Director Carmen Balber to talk about how special interests dominate the initiative process and how electronic signatures can restore citizens’ access to the ballot.
